Where DCENT_OS stands now
All 13 Antminer models in the canonical registry carry the public status shown above. Experimental is intended for testing, development, informed operators and non-critical deployments. It is not Stable or GA and is not recommended for an irreplaceable fleet.
Release availability does not erase hardware limits. Verified prebuilt files, accepted-share evidence, installation authorization and recovery maturity remain separate for every exact model and board lane.
Artifact authentication boundary: All 3 outer files have SHA-256 receipts. 2 sysupgrade archives contain a verified embedded Ed25519 payload manifest. DCENTOS_XIL1_S9_SD_beta20260709.img has a SHA-256 receipt only: no embedded or detached signature. No detached signature for the outer files or SHA256SUMS.txt is claimed.
There is no mandatory developer fee. A disableable 2% donation ships on by default and can be set to zero. Treat that behavior as build-specific and verify it in the GPL-3.0 source and the exact build you run.

The four firmwares this wizard chooses between
The wizard asks five questions and then explains itself. Here is the same reasoning in one place, so you can read it without answering anything — and so a search engine can too.
BraiinsOS+
Braiins publishes native Stratum V2, per-chip autotuning, immersion support, exact model/control-board downloads and GPG verification. Its current fee is 2–2.5% depending on hardware. Braiins also publishes meaningful open components and BCB100 hardware; the complete mining firmware is not published as open source. Its site reports operation since 2018 and hundreds of thousands of miners; those fleet figures remain vendor-reported.
VNish and LuxOS
VNish publishes model-specific builds, tuning controls and model-dependent fees; its current pages list 2.8% for S19/S21 and 2% for L7/L9, while older-model terms differ. LuxOS publishes a 2.8% fee, exact Antminer and WhatsMiner board/hashboard lanes, fleet controls, and vendor claims of SOC 2 Type 2 status and reducing a miner to about 25 W in under five seconds. The reviewed vendor pages did not document native Stratum V2 or a general household-voltage route for either product; those cells are not verified, not categorical negatives.
AxeOS (Bitaxe and open hardware)
AxeOS publishes source for Bitaxe-class open hardware. It is a different electrical and operational class from an industrial Antminer, so verify protocol support, board coverage and the exact release at the project source rather than flattening the two.
Stock (Bitmain)
Stock Bitmain firmware is the manufacturer recovery and support baseline and carries no third-party firmware fee. Features, security policy and installation packages vary by exact model and release. Use the model-matched vendor record, then run your own fee, electricity and measured-efficiency inputs through the cost-of-ownership calculator.
One thing that is true of all of them
Published tuning algorithms, voltage domains and eligible boards differ. Compare accepted hashrate, wall power, rejects, temperature and stability under equivalent conditions, and stay within the exact PSU, circuit and cooling limits. No universal tuning gain is assumed to exceed the effective fee.
